The price difference here is more. A fully loaded M5 is about 108k and a very well loaded PTT is 160k. There is an article in Car and Driver mag, and they compared the M5 vs E63 vs S6 and the M5 got last place. They had some serious critism of things that an M5 should be excelling at. Until I drive one, my thoughts are not positive about it.
A tough decision indeed Teff but I think you've already got yoru mind made up. I suggest driving the 2 cars back to back along with a Panny GTS. According to a few members the Panny GTS is hands down a better (although a little slower) car compared to the Panny Turbo. Being a DD I don't know if the lesser hp for the better car would be that bad of a trade off.
